Subject: On-call heads-up — Orchardly catalog cache. Welcome aboard. The main gotcha: catalog price updates invalidate by SKU, but bundle pages cache composite keys, so a stale bundle can outlive its parts. If support reports wrong bundle prices, purge the composite namespace first. We'll cover this at the weekly sync; the invalidation playbook is on this internal page.

wiki page, yagef-tawif: https://sentry.lumicdata.local/view/merge_requests/pipeline/merge_requests/e08f7f35c80b5755

## Runbook: Gaugepile Sidecar — Release Checklist

Heads up: the sidecar ships with every app pod, so a bad config fans out fast. Before cutting a release, confirm the flush interval hasn't drifted from what the Tallyhouse aggregator expects, or you'll see sawtooth gaps in dashboards. Rollbacks are cheap — just repin the image tag. Canary one node pool first, watch for ten minutes, then proceed. The values to verify against are these.

config for bagep-yafof:
quenath:
  pin: 8584
  metrics_host: metrics.quenath.tolvaqsys.internal
  tenant: pelath
  seal: seal_ed102645

### Telemetry payload compression

If the Larkspur collector rejects compressed telemetry with a 413, verify the agent applies zstd before framing, not after; double-compressed payloads inflate by roughly 8%. Check that the content-encoding flag matches the actual codec and that chunk sizes stay under the 2 MB gateway limit. Reviewers should confirm the regression test covers mixed-codec batches. To replay a failing batch against staging, authenticate using the bearer token below.

session JWT of yawep-yawep = eyJhbGciOiJIUzI1NiIsInR5cCI6IkpXVCJ9.eyJzdWIiOiI3pWF3_In0.aXYsHiog

**Vendor note: Inkmill markdown pipeline**

Rendering for Parchway docs is outsourced to Inkmill under an annual contract, renewing each March. They handle sanitization and PDF export; we own the upload queue. SLA: 4-hour response on rendering failures. Escalate only after two failed retries. Their support desk is reachable at the address below.

billing contact of hahaf-baguf = zorael.tammir.jorius@sivrelhq.internal